The United States has strongly condemned the horrific and indiscriminate Boko Haram suicide attack on the Grand Marche in the Chadian capital of N’Djamena on Saturday.
 
It has equally condemned the  attacks in Cameroon, Niger, and Nigeria over the past two days.
 
The condemnation was contained in a statement by the U.S. Department of State spokesperson,  Washington, D.C., John Kirby
 
"Boko Haram’s targeting of men, women, and children highlights that the group’s brutality and barbarism know no bounds, and we remain committed to working closely with the region to root out the threat posed by the group.
 
"We extend our deepest condolences to the families and loved ones of the soldiers, government officials, and civilians killed; we hope those who were injured will recover quickly. 
 
"The United States praises the security forces of Cameroon, Chad, Niger, and Nigeria for their timely responses to these callous and cowardly attacks on innocent civilians.“
